  5. advanced rules does actually cover what is and is not crew, silicon side states being on manifest makes you crew, vampires for example are still crew as far as the rules page goes while a wizard is not unless they somehow were to get themselves officially on the crew manifest. the one exception is changelings which the adv rules clearly states they are not crew.
